The Senior Interior Designer will oversee the design process from conception to completion, create design concepts, collaborate with clients and team members, supervise junior designers, manage budgets, and ensure project timelines are met.
In this role, you'll be able to utilize your design expertise as you manage and design a diverse array of residential to boutique hospitality and commercial projects, from inception to installation.

Qualifications
- A bachelor’s or master’s degree in interior design, Architecture, or related field
- 5 years of experience in interior design, architecture, or a related field
- Excellent design skills with an eye for aesthetics and attention to detail
- Software abilities in AutoCAD, Revit, Studio Designer, and other design software
- Experience in project management and team leadership
- Strong communication and presentation skills
- Ability to work well in a team and collaborate with clients and team members
- NCIDQ or other relevant certifications are a plus
- Experience with sustainable design and LEED certification is a plus
- Experience with project management software is a plus
